    The file w?nspool.exe is most likely named winspool.exe, and you will probably find 2 files of the same name in the system32 folder. One is a legitimate Microsoft file, the other is rogue. The malware writers are now using some new tricks to give filenames the same name as system files, and allow 2 files of the same name to reside within the same folder, but the method they use leaves HijackThis unable to recognize one or more letters, hence the ? in the filename. Tread with caution here! Winspool.exe may be required for your printer. Check the properties of each file to try determining which is rogue and delete it. If unsure, post details of the properties for each. You could also try renaming one of them to winspool.old and scan them both with jotti to identify which is bad.

    Your log looks good, although you still need to install those Windows Updates.

    I also suggest you download and install SpywareBlaster. Enable all protections, check for updates and enable them too. Then download IESpyad.exe, double click to extract (it extracts to C:\IESpyad by default), open the folder, double click the ie-ads.reg file and allow it to merge into the registry.

    An online virus scan with Panda ActiveScan wouldn't hurt either. If any infected files are found, save the report and post it here.
